Solution for 9z+8-3z=2+4z+2 equation:


Simplifying
9z + 8 + -3z = 2 + 4z + 2

Reorder the terms:
8 + 9z + -3z = 2 + 4z + 2

Combine like terms: 9z + -3z = 6z
8 + 6z = 2 + 4z + 2

Reorder the terms:
8 + 6z = 2 + 2 + 4z

Combine like terms: 2 + 2 = 4
8 + 6z = 4 + 4z

Solving
8 + 6z = 4 + 4z

Solving for variable 'z'.

Move all terms containing z to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-4z' to each side of the equation.
8 + 6z + -4z = 4 + 4z + -4z

Combine like terms: 6z + -4z = 2z
8 + 2z = 4 + 4z + -4z

Combine like terms: 4z + -4z = 0
8 + 2z = 4 + 0
8 + 2z = 4

Add '-8' to each side of the equation.
8 + -8 + 2z = 4 + -8

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0
0 + 2z = 4 + -8
2z = 4 + -8

Combine like terms: 4 + -8 = -4
2z = -4

Divide each side by '2'.
z = -2

Simplifying
z = -2
